No ships got through in first 24 hours: How US is enforcing a sweeping blockade on Iranian ports
US forces have imposed a naval blockade on Iranian ports, halting all maritime trade in and out of the country.
Over 10,000 personnel and numerous warships are enforcing the operation, impacting vessels of all nations.
This move escalates regional tensions, with global energy markets already feeling the strain.
